The Ottawa Hospital (TOH) is one of Canada’s largest learning and research multi-campus hospitals. With more than 1,400 beds and approximately 17,000 staff, physicians, residents and volunteers, we deliver specialized care to the Eastern Ontario, Western Quebec and Eastern Nunavut regions. Position Information

This position presents an excellent opportunity to join the leadership team at the University of Ottawa Heart Institute (UOHI).

Join a team that is regionally, nationally, and internationally recognized as a leader in cardiac care. If you are an individual that is seeking a new opportunity to grow and develop your leadership competencies in a fast-paced and acute clinical environment, then this position may be the right fit for you!

The Clinical Administrator On-Site provides administrative leadership and expert clinical support to staff across all campuses throughout the organization during evenings, nights, weekends, statutory holidays, and other days as required.

The role is responsible for the security of patients and safety of staff, providing support for complex patients or situations, and crisis management/counseling for patients and families. This role will also provide advice to internal and external stakeholders on processes and controls, including initiation and coordination of hospital codes and disaster responses. Additionally, this role will execute operational duties that include bed management, patient flow, staff oversight, discipline, and cost containment through responsible staff utilization/strategic movement to high volume, high acuity areas, as needed.

The Clinical Administrator On Site applies learning and accountability consistent with a just culture, providing staff with written instruction on safety precautions where appropriate, ensuring that staff adhere to standards of safe work and patient care, and closing the loop on staff and patient safety issues to ensure continuous improvement.

What you will bring

  • Baccalaureate Degree in Nursing;
  • Certificate of Registration from the College of Nurses of Ontario as a Registered Nurse;
  • Five (5) years’ recent experience in the areas of in cardiac care (cardiology and or/cardiac surgery) and/or intensive care;
  • Leadership experience in a fast-paced and acute clinical environment
  • Demonstrates theoretical knowledge of the nursing process and the ability to apply this in a clinical setting;
  • Demonstrates the ability to communicate effectively, in oral and written formats, with patients, public, staff, colleagues and members of other health disciplines;
  • Demonstrates a productive approach to conflict resolution;
  • Demonstrates the ability to identify issues, establish priorities and resolve problems;
  • Demonstrates a commitment to continuing education;
  • Demonstrates an understanding of and participation in the evaluation process;
  • Demonstrates a professional and respectful attitude towards patients, the public and colleagues;
  • Demonstrates an understanding of and commitment to continuous quality improvement;
  • Demonstrates the ability to coordinate work and to participate effectively as a member of the health-care team;
  • Eligible to work in Canada.

You will stand out with

  • Master of Nursing, Health Administration or other related field of study;
  • Member of the RNAO and/or other related professional groups or associations;
  • Proficiency in English and French – oral expression (advanced level) and comprehension (advanced level).
